Abstract
Vacuole-free films, filaments and fibers consisting of a polymer mixture which comprises a copolymer of acrylonitrile and a polymer which is obtained by a polymer-analogue reaction of a polyacrylic acid ester with dimethylamine, said polymer containing from 40-99 mol % of N,N-dimethyl acrylamide units.
